Dynamic Redirect URL: send the users to custom links in an Airtable field.Custom Confirmation Page: choose a custom success message (thank you screen) or redirect to a URL.Custom Styling: an option to customize the cover image, logo, buttons.etc.Footer Section: add custom notes to the bottom. Multi-Page: the ability to break the form into pages.Section Headers: the ability to add a “title block” to group a set of fields together and separate them.Image option: you can add an image in any field.Default Value: auto-fill specific fields without needing to prefill parameters in the URL.Field Validation: prevent form submissions if conditions aren’t met.Duplicate Prevention: you can prevent duplicate records with the same value.Prefill Hidden Fields: form can be pre-filled using prefill_ parameters ( including hidden fields!).Conditional Fields: show some fields or section only when certain requirements are met.Read-only fields: disable editing some fields (or lock them all to share record previews only).Multi-purpose: create new records or update existing records (or even delete them).If this is not exactly what you’re looking for, we have a few similar extensions:įorm with Login Page, Form with Lookup Page, or even our Search Page extension. From there, you can configure your form modal.Īny user who has access to your Interface can access the forms you make to create new records. Select either of these elements and toggle “Allow users to create new records” in the properties panel. You can add forms to existing pages that include a Record List or a Record Picker.This should be available any time you create a new page in an Interface. Create a full-screen form using the new form layout.Using the full power of the Interface Designer layout engine, you can customize exactly what information you’d like your users to enter each time they create a new record.
